The contact owns a 2002 GMC Sierra 1500. While applying pressure to the brake pedal to stop the vehicle, the abs engaged automatically. This caused the vehicle to jerk dramatically instead of stopping. The dealer stated that his vehicle was not included in NHTSA campaign id number 05v379000 (service brakes, hydraulic:anti lock). The vehicle has not been repaired. He filed a formal complaint with the manufacturer. The current mileage was 53,000 and failure mileage was 50,000. Updated 01-11-08. Updated 12/31/07.
Anti- lock brakes on my 2003 GMC sierra are chattering and not stopping properly at low speeds. This is the same defect that is subject to recall but only up to the 2002 model. I would like to have my vehicle included in this or subsequent recalls.
The contact owns a 2003 GMC Sierra 1500. While driving 5 mph, the antilock brakes activated when the brake pedal was depressed. The dealer has not inspected the vehicle. Recall # 05v379000 (service brakes, hydraulic:antilock) does not include the 2003 model. The contact felt that his vehicle should be included in the recall. The current mileage is 26,000 and failure mileage was 25,500.

Vehicle brake anti-lock engages at low speed. 1 occurrence of loss of brakes while slowing on steep hill. This is a constant problem every time I stop at a traffic light, stop sign or parking. My model year is not included in a recall for the exact same problem in earlier model years.
: the contact stated that the vehicle was experiencing unwarranted antilock brake system (abs) activation. This condition is more likely to occur in environmentally corrosive areas. The vehicle is registered in michigan. The vehicle was taken to the dealer on 12/15/06 who determined that the vehicle could be repaired at cost. There is a NHTSA recall #05v379000, regarding the service brakes, hydraulic: antilock. The VIN was not included in the recall.
